Strategic IT Planning procedural methodology
The preparation and maintenance of IT strategies within the Federal Administration follow the Strategic IT Planning (SIP) procedural methodology.
The Digital Transformation and ICT Steering Sector DTI has the task of developing and implementing the strategy on information and communication technologies (ICT) in the Federal Administration.
The basis for the federal government’s ICT strategy is set out in the Ordinance on the Coordination of Digital Transformation and ICT Steering in the Federal Administration (DTITO), which was adopted by the Federal Council on 25 November 2020. It sets out the tasks, competences and responsibilities regarding the steering and management of ICT at federal level.

The strategy ensures that ICT is oriented towards business affairs and is approved by the Federal Council every four years as a high-ranking general guideline for the management of ICT use within the Federal Administration.
